Flights to Taiwan
Taiwan has a total of 12 airports, Taipei Airport (TPE) serves as a hub for intercontinental travel, 5 of these airports handle international flights. Currently, 11 airports offer domestic flights. 7 of these airports exclusively serve domestic flights. All airports in Taiwan together handle 10,746 flights this month, departing from 115 airports in 30 countries, operated by 59 different airlines — including 17 low-cost carriers. What is the best time to visit Taiwan?
Taiwan has destinations with multiple climate types which are humid subtropical, tropical and oceanic / maritime destinations. This means that the best time to visit depends on the destination you choose. However, considering most destinations and their weather, the best time to explore Taiwan as a whole is from April to October, during mid-spring to mid-autumn. 🌺 💦 Humid Subtropical destinations
The Humid Subtropical or Warm Temperate destinations in Taiwan have hot, humid summers — with temperatures around 30°C (86°F) — and mild to cool winters, with year-round rainfall that often peaks during the summer months. These places are known for their lively cities, diverse natural landscapes, and a wide range of outdoor activities.
Taiwan has 9 Warm Temperate / Humid Subtropical destinations that you can fly to. Although those destinations can be visited throughout the year, it is recommended to visit from April to June, or from August to October.





🌴 Tropical destinations
The tropical spots in Taiwan are famous for their consistently warm temperatures, ranging from 25°C to 30°C (77°F to 86°F) throughout the year, along with high humidity and rainfall, especially in rainforest and monsoon areas.
Taiwan also has destinations North of the equator, where the dry season starts in November and ends in April, making this period the best to visit the country's tropical destinations. During these months it is mainly dry, while in the wet season there can be long periods of rain. Humidity and temperatures are high all year round. 🌊 🌧️ Oceanic / Maritime destinations
Oceanic destinations in Taiwan have mild summer temperatures, typically ranging from 15°C to 25°C (59°F to 77°F), while winters are pleasantly cool without being freezing. You can enjoy beautiful green surroundings, a variety of flora and fauna, and plenty of outdoor adventures. Ideally suited for anyone who enjoys the temperate weather.
There is 1 oceanic / maritime destination in Taiwan accessible by plane. This destination is best to visit in the summer months from May to August. During this period, temperatures are pleasant to warm, while precipitation often falls in autumn and winter, from September to February.

Domestic flights across Taiwan
With a total of 38 domestic routes, there are many flights within Taiwan that make it easy to travel around the country. Magong, Taipei and Kinmen have the most domestic connections, helpful to know when planning your trip.
Uni Air is responsible for 56% of these domestic flights (1,938 in March) and is therefore a very suitable airline for flying domestically. The list below provides you with a lot more information, from interesting statistics to an overview of all domestic routes.

What is the longest flight to Taiwan?
The longest direct flight is from Houston, United States (IAH) to Taipei (TPE). This flight takes 16 hours and 40 minutes and covers a distance of 7,922 miles (12,749 km). Other interesting long-haul flights to Taiwan include:
